    Ricky Hatton Applies For Promoters License

    Light Welterweight Champion Ricky “Hitman” Hatton has applied for a promoters license to the Britain Boxing Board of Control. Hatton has not publicly discussed any promotional dates or fighters who will battle under his banner but rest assure, England’s favorite fighter will have significant influence on boxing in the UK and throughout the world. Coming off a December loss to Floyd Mayweather, Hatton has yet to name a comeback opponent but it appears the “Hitman” will enter the ring on May 24th, most likely in Manchester.
